Concrete Foundation Pouring Questions
What types of projects require concrete foundation pouring? Foundation pouring is typically needed for new construction, home additions, or repairs to stabilize and support structures on a property in Greenville, SC.
How long does a concrete foundation pour usually take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the project, but generally, it involves preparation, pouring, and curing phases over several days.
What should property owners know before the foundation is poured? Proper site preparation, accurate measurements, and ensuring proper drainage are essential to achieve a stable and durable foundation.
Are there different types of concrete foundations available? Yes, options include slab-on-grade, crawl space, and basement foundations, each suited to different types of structures and soil conditions in Greenville, SC.
